I have always been interested in outer space. Ever since I could remember I have always been fascinated by the universe. I have been an amateur astronomer for well over a decade now, and in the past several years I have expanded into the world of astrophotography.

I was actually an astrophotographer before I got heavily into "regular" photography. Astrophotographer's are the crazy ones of the astronomy world. We brave the extreme cold and spend long, lonely nights capturing photons that have traveled across the vast reaches of space to land on the imaging chip in the cameras. Not to mention this hobby is like a black hole for bank accounts, especially with all the cool new equipment coming out all the time now.

So above are some of my best shots. I am by no means a pro at this, but I think I am getting some pretty good results so far.
